Brazilian national Fabricio Da Silva Claudino has confessed to a series of public masturbation charges, having promoted the sex acts in explicit videos posted for his army of online followers.

Claudino has pleaded guilty to 15 counts of wilful or obscene exposure and one of offensive behaviour for the acts committed in Surry Hills between September 2019 and February 2020.

The former Emirates flight attendant, who has tens of thousands of followers on Instagram and Twitter, filmed himself exposing his penis in and around his apartment on Chalmers St – including in view of Inner Sydney High School, on a footpath and in Prince Alfred Park

It all came when he was on bail for a string revenge porn charges.

Central Local Court heard on Tuesday Claudino, 31, was keen to learn his punishment having been in custody for almost four months since his arrest in February.

He would likely be extradited back to Brazil following the completion of any sentence, the court heard.

Known online as ‘FabricioMonkey’, he faces a further 11 charges of taking and distributing without consent several sensitive images and a video of his former lover between July 16 and July 30, 2019.

It is alleged Claudino filmed himself having sex with the man, who cannot be named, and uploaded them to his profile on subscriber porn site OnlyFans without his partner’s knowledge.

The Surry Hills man is also charged with destroying a T-shirt and for possession of anabolic steroids.

The court also heard on Tuesday those matters would be dealt with together with the public exposure matters when Claudino was sentenced at the Downing Centre on July 21.

He had previously pleaded not guilty to the charges, which return to Burwood Local Court on Thursday.

The court has previously heard Claudino was in Australia on a tourist visa and was “supporting himself” through his online videos.

In March, a GoFundMe page set up by supporters to raise $8000 for Claudino’s legal fees was taken down after it breached the website’s terms and conditions through the use of misleading statements.
